PHILADELPHIA (AP) -- Philadelphia 76ers forward Marreese Speights will miss six to eight weeks with a left knee injury.

Speights was injured in the fourth quarter of a 94-88 loss at Chicago on Saturday night. An MRI on Sunday revealed he has a partial tear of the medial collateral ligament in his left knee.
Speights has averaged 13 points and 6.4 rebounds in the first 10 games. He averaged 7.7 points and 3.7 rebounds as a rookie last year.
